Understanding Synthetic Oil
Synthetic oil is a type of lubricant that is designed to provide superior performance and protection for your vehicle’s engine. It is formulated to meet the demands of modern engines, which are designed to operate at higher temperatures and under increased stress. Synthetic oil is made from chemical compounds that are designed to provide better lubrication, better wear protection, and better cold-start performance than conventional oil.

How Often to Change Synthetic Oil
The frequency of synthetic oil changes depends on a number of factors, including the type of vehicle you drive, the type of synthetic oil you use, and your driving habits. Here are some general guidelines to follow:
Typical Maintenance Schedule
| Vehicle Type | Synthetic Oil Change Interval |
|---|---|
| Passenger vehicles | 7,500 to 15,000 miles |
| Light trucks and SUVs | 5,000 to 10,000 miles |
| High-performance vehicles | 3,000 to 5,000 miles |
| Racing vehicles | 1,000 to 3,000 miles |
It’s important to note that these are general guidelines and that the actual maintenance schedule for your vehicle may vary. Factors That Affect Synthetic Oil Change Interval
- Driving habits
- Vehicle type
- Climate
- Load
- Age of the vehicle
The frequency of synthetic oil changes can be affected by a number of factors, including driving habits, vehicle type, climate, load, and age of the vehicle. For example, if you drive in extreme temperatures or carry heavy loads, you may need to change your synthetic oil more frequently. Similarly, if you drive in stop-and-go traffic or tow a trailer, you may need to change your synthetic oil more frequently.
